TGR Foundation announces scholarship endowment for New York cohort in partnership with Liberty National Foundation

IRVINE, Calif. and JERSEY CITY N.J., September 16, 2026 - TGR Foundation and Liberty National Foundation announced a partnership that establishes an endowment for its Earl Woods Scholar Program to support students from under-resourced communities in New York and New Jersey.

“We’re grateful for the partnership and support of the Liberty National Foundation,” said Cyndi Court, TGR Foundation CEO. “We’re committed to working together to provide opportunities for young people from under-resourced communities that will change the trajectory of their lives.”

The Liberty National Foundation has committed a $1.2 million gift that will fund a cohort of five scholars selected annually beginning in 2025. This endowment ensures that the Liberty National Foundation cohort is funded in perpetuity.

“We are thrilled to announce this new partnership with TGR Foundation,” said Dan Fireman, Liberty National Foundation Executive Chairman and co-founder of Liberty National Golf Club. “This is what it’s all about, helping the next generation find their footing and doing what we can to ensure they are successful in whatever it is they decide to do with their futures. We couldn’t be prouder of these students and look forward to supporting and mentoring them on their journey.” 

The Liberty National Foundation was established in 2024 by Paul and Dan Fireman, co-founders of Liberty National Golf Club, along with a group of likeminded members of the club with a passion for giving back and helping others. The partnership builds on both foundations’ commitment to supporting young people and using the game of golf for good.

Established in 2006, the Earl Woods Scholar Program was created to honor the vision and spirit of the late Earl Woods, Tiger Woods’ father and mentor. Holding one of the highest graduation rates among scholarship programs in the country, the renewable scholarship supports students throughout their four years in college and beyond. In addition to academic excellence, scholars accepted into the program demonstrate a commitment to service, aligned with the Woods family legacy of sharing and caring. 

“We are excited about this new partnership with the Liberty National Foundation,” said Tiger Woods, founder of TGR Foundation. “Their investment in our scholar program will help more students receive the support needed to chase their dreams.”

With the support of the Liberty National Foundation, the new cohort will start college this fall. The five scholars were chosen from a competitive pool of applicants who were referred to the program by teachers and school counselors and selected by TGR Foundation. The Liberty National Foundation cohort includes:

  • Anusha Alam – NEST+m 
  • Mohammad Ali – Robert F Wagner Jr. SSAT
  • Jessica Gyamfi – Brooklyn Latin School
  • Samuel Paing – The Bronx High School of Science
  • Fatoumata Sow – Harlem Village Academies High School

The scholars are attending higher education institutions across the country including University of Southern California, City College of New York, Wesleyan University, Middlebury College and Bowdoin College.

This group of students is one cohort of TGR Foundation’s Earl Woods Scholar Class of 2029, including 14 additional scholars from Orange County, Calif, Los Angeles, Philadelphia, Pa, and the Washington, D.C.-Maryland-Virginia area.

The Earl Woods Scholar Program currently serves 94 scholars attending universities across the country. Beyond financial aid, all scholars receive wraparound services as they work toward their college and career goals. In addition to monthly workshops and opportunities, signature components of the program include one-to-one mentorship, internship placement assistance and career counseling.

About TGR Foundation
For more than 28 years, TGR Foundation has worked to create a world where opportunity is universal and potential is limitless. With an unwavering commitment to positively impacting youth from under-resourced communities, its mission is to empower students to pursue their passions through education. TGR Foundation helps students learn, grow and prepare for their futures through a network of TGR Learning Labs and national programs focused on STEAM educational enrichment, health and well-being and career and college career readiness. About Liberty National Foundation
Founded in 2024, by Paul and Dan Fireman, along with a group of philanthropic minded members of Liberty National Golf Club in Jersey City, NJ, the Liberty National Foundation’s mission is to unite its members and partners in a shared commitment to support youth, veterans, first responders, and our community. Together, we are committed to creating lasting social impact by enhancing lives and fostering a culture of compassion and generosity within - and beyond - the world of golf.
